I'm using Progress OpenEdge.

I've created a dataset and nested a few temp-tables. I put in specific fields in order to relate the temp-tables.

In xml if you want to hide the fields that you use to relate the temp-tables you would use xml-node-type "HIDDEN" next to the field where you defined the temp-table.

So when you view the xml document after "dataset handle":write-xml("whatever-paramters"). The relation fields aren't seen.

The question...

How do I do the same with json?

I can't find anything that would resemble xml's xml-node-type "HIDDEN".

See the SERIALIZE-HIDDEN attribute.
